Alfred McDonald was born in Warooka, South Australia in May 1889. He was the son of Neil McDonald and Fanny Meddiford.
Mick served in the 3rd Light Horse Regiment in the Australian Imperial Force. He died of wounds in Port Said, Egypt on 3 June 1916, and was buried in Port Said War Memorial Cemetery.[1]
